Genome-wide analysis and characterization of dendrocalamus farinosus sut gene family reveal dfsut4 involvement in sucrose transportation in plants

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Bin Deng and colleagues from the Shanxi University, China have published the research: Genome-wide analysis and characterization of Dendrocalamus farinosus SUT gene family reveal DfSUT4 involvement in sucrose transportation in plants,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
  • how: These results showed that except the leaf source and the root sink the bamboo node that consists of complex vascular bundles in D. farinosus might be a temporary sink for the accumulation of sucrose for some specific functions. The result showed that four chromosomes (DfA10 DfB08 DfB09 and DfB10) harbored only one gene and they were DfSUT2 . . .
